About Us

Ramsey Solutions provides biblically based, commonsense education and empowerment that give HOPE to everyone in every walk of life. Founded by Dave Ramsey, a household name in personal finance since 1992, our mission is to change the toxic money culture for good. We experience resistance every day because what we believe is absolutely countercultural—we hate debt, cut up credit cards, and are committed to helping people achieve financial freedom.
